How to fix?

Upgrade Debian:9 shiro to version 1.2.3-1 or higher.

NVD Description

Note: Versions mentioned in the description apply only to the upstream shiro package and not the shiro package as distributed by Debian. See How to fix? for Debian:9 relevant fixed versions and status.

Apache Shiro 1.x before 1.2.3, when using an LDAP server with unauthenticated bind enabled, allows remote attackers to bypass authentication via an empty (1) username or (2) password.
